if the ratio of tourists to locals is 2:5 and there are 50 tourists at the opening of a new museum how many locals are in attendance

Ratio: 2 tourist: 5 locals

To find the number of locals you multiply the given number of tourits by 5/2:


50\text{tourist}\cdot\frac{5\text{locals}}{2\text{touritst}}=125\text{locals}Then, when there are 50 tourist, there are 125 locals
